摘要
The sorption of xanthate on pyrite from which oxides and sulfoxides have been partially removed is insignificant (10 to 15%). The addition of sodium sulfite to the xanthate solution (ph equals 7. 3 to 10) leads to a reduction of its concentration. The rate of reduction of the xanthate concentration depends on the type of xanthate, the sulfite concentration, the solution storage time, the degree of dilution of the solution, the addition of a sulfite oxidation inhibitor (for example, thiosulfate), the solution pH, and certain other factors.
